Crackdown in Quetta for violating price control laws, 22 arrested, illegal petrol pumps sealed

The Quetta district administration on Tuesday launched a major crackdown on violations of price control laws, resulting in the arrest of 22 individuals and the imprisonment of 13 for various regulatory breaches. During this extensive operation, several commercial centers, including illegal mini petrol pumps, were also shut down.

In a special operation against unsafe and illegal activities, authorities shut down five illegal mini petrol pumps and sealed an additional six shops. During the campaign, 40 kilograms of prohibited plastic bags were also confiscated from various shopkeepers.

During the operation, a total of 76 shops and markets across the city were inspected. Fines amounting to Rs. 50,000 were imposed on owners found violating local laws related to price control, encroachments, and the use of prohibited items.

These comprehensive actions were carried out in the Saryab, City, and Saddar subdivisions. These operations were personally supervised by Special Magistrates Izzatullah, Dr. Imran Zeb, and Haseeb Sardar to ensure strict enforcement of district regulations.
